It happens only in India: Ramayan hero Arun Govil honored as Lord Ram by a woman; video goes viral  

The Ramayan TV series by Ramanand Sagar was extremely popular in the 1990s. However, even decades later, the popularity of the venerable show hasn’t diminished in the slightest. A recent popular video serves as evidence for this. Arun Govil, who plays Lord Ram, was recently observed at the airport. What made his outing noteworthy was the love of one of his admirers. The fact that he ran into one of his ardent supporters outside the airport grounds is unmistakable.

In the viral video, a woman is seen touching Arun Govil’s feet and treating him with respect when he is at the airport. Despite feeling uncomfortable in the situation, the actor continues their brief interaction. Even at one point, the woman squats down in front of him and clasps her hands.
